
Texas Tech Outlasts Arizona State in Double Overtime Thriller
A thrilling college basketball showdown saw JT Toppin lead Texas Tech to a 111-106 victory over Arizona State.
When one team is 9-3 in the Big 12, and the other is 3-9, and the team that’s 9-3 is at home, and that team that’s 3-9 is missing its best freshman, there’s no real reason to expect an instant classic. You can hope for one, sure, but there are few tangible things to attach to that hope.
Final score: Texas Tech 111, Arizona State 106 in 2 OT.
Incredible game.
And JT Toppin was awesome. The 6-foot-9 sophomore from Dallas took 22 shots, made 17 of them and finished with a career-high 41 points, 15 rebounds, three steals, and two blocks.
“In a game where it’s open-flow like this, and you can give him some space, he’s so dynamic – but having shooters around him gives him that space,” Texas Tech coach Grant McCasland told me late Wednesday.
